Fertility insurance coverage is complicated, and no two health plans are exactly alike. Some plans cover only diagnostic testing, while others may cover limited treatment options—but exclude IVF. Many also have lifetime maximums (like a $20,000 cap), which can be used up quickly during treatment.
It’s also important to know that even if we’re “in-network,” certain services—like labs, anesthesia, or pharmacy—might be billed separately and considered out-of-network. This is why transparency is at the heart of how we work with patients.
